What a life! What a legacy! What an inspiration!

“What will matter is not what you bought, but what you built;
not what you got, but what you gave.
What will matter is not what you learned, but what you taught.
What will matter is every act of integrity, compassion, courage or sacrifice that enriched, empowered or encouraged others.”
Michael Josephson

This epitomises the life of Charmouth resident, James Ray Wilkinson, whose celebration of life I had the honour of conducting yesterday.
As a woodworking and outdoor pursuits teacher, Ray built a 28ft boat – Odette, from one inch strip planking, persuaded future wife, Julia, to crew for him on an epic journey from the Bahamas to the UK and nearly drowned in the process!
Back in the UK, he developed outdoor pursuits centres for teachers and students, day sailing centres in Essex and built racing dinghies from fibreglass moulds to enable Essex schools to win 5 out of 5 races.
Ray’s determination, vision, people skills and sense of humour made him a leader that it was a joy to work with and changed the lives of thousands of people and will continue as ripple effect of impact across the world.

"Living a life that matters doesn’t happen by accident.
It’s not a matter of circumstance but of choice.
Choose to live a life that matters." Michael Josephson
